Google Unveils Vishing Operation UNC6040 Targeting Salesforce with Fake Data Loader App

June 4, 2025
Threat Intelligence / Data Breach

Google has revealed insights into a financially driven threat group called UNC6040, which specializes in voice phishing (vishing) tactics aimed at infiltrating organizations’ Salesforce accounts for extensive data theft and extortion efforts. The tech giant’s threat intelligence team has linked this group to an online cybercrime network known as The Com. According to a report shared with The Hacker News, UNC6040 has successfully breached multiple networks by having its operators impersonate IT support staff in persuasive telephone-based social engineering campaigns. This method has effectively deceived English-speaking employees into taking actions that grant the attackers access or encourage them to share sensitive information.
